1. TM XM177-E2 Upgraded 350 FPS- WOW! I LOVE this gun. Nice and compact, feather lite (mostly plastic so I have to be careful), and really accurate! The EG 700 Motor reduces it's ROF a bit but what it lakes in ROF it makes up with power. My friend HiGhGrOuNd#1 felt a burst from the XM from about 15-20 yards away and he he had a sweater on with a few shirts on underneath and he still let out a yelp, so I'm very happy with its performance. Pretty much the only downers are the ROF and the plastic. The ROF I can deal with but I have to baby the gun and make sure I dont hit it on anything, so I may be buying some metal components for it in the future. The Mil-Tech Tactical 3 point sling is great. It adjusts to you as you put it on and feels like its not there. It keeps the stock of the gun snug to my shoulder so I can snap it up in an instant. The magazine thigh pouch (the one from airsoftshop it didnt come in a branded box) is great! You can even adjust it to hold about 4 MP5 mags, with the help of cross over velcro straps to change formation of the pouch and keep everything snug inside.
2. AE MP5-A5 V1... Well it isnt as good as a CA or TM MP5 but it's ok. The highcap mag wouldnt feed so I had to buy some standard TM mags. Now the gun works fine and why I dont see why everyone badmouths AE guns I think it's handy in CQB because of the ROF but it's not good for outdoors because of its lack of range. I taped the two mags together (one upsidedown) and that works fine for me. Nice fast reload and you dont have to pay for those dual magazine clamps. I dont really go prone but if you do I dont recomend tapeing your mags because the dirt will get in your mag and all over the bbs. The CA Tactical 3 Point Sling I got was confuseing at first but works like a charm once you hook it up. The day my new stuff came for the A5 me and some friends had a few small games and it was easy to drop the A5 and wip out my 226 or slide the A5 on my back to hop over my brick wall by the garage. Doesnt get in the way at all, so its a good buy for the MP5 user.
3. KWC SIG P-226 GBB, This gun has its difficulties. It's a nice gun and looks and feels great but the gas valve is on such an angle that you dont know if your getting the gas in or not so when it comes to game time and you need your sidearm, you may or may not be screwed. So if you were willing to go through a lot of gas cans its worth the money. The range is great and I'm not sure what the FPS but it hurts (hehe Tommy dont shoot my screen porch again!). I kinda wish this gun had a slidelock for when the mag is out, just for looks but I can deal with it.
